YES. Property values can decline from close proximity with utility-scale solar farms, but the losses are modest and less than from nearby fossil fuel plants. One 2023 study of 1.8 million homes found minor impacts on property values.
Homes within 0.5 miles of solar farms experienced around 1.5% price reductions; homes more than one mile away received no significant effects.
